Public Sector Fraud Brief Taken Off Louise Haigh, Who Still Oversees Ethics
Louise Haigh as Chancellor of the Duchy of Lancaster and first secretary will not have oversight of the Public Sector Fraud Authority (PSFA) which deals departments to “understand and reduce the impact of fraud.” That is moving to the Department of Work and Pensions as part of the overhaul of the Cabinet Office this morning.…
